It’s probably not every day you see a distillery advocating to not drink spirits for a month. Truthfully, we didn’t know if this was a good idea until you all told us.


As Lindsay Christians wrote in The Cap Times, we’ve always had and will have non-alcoholic options available at the cocktail lounge, like our non-alcoholic Dealer’s Choice. However, you can only combine citrus & syrups so many ways before you’re craving something exciting, and with most of our staff and a large part of the Madison community deciding to participate in Dry January this year, we knew we had to find a way to make sure our community felt supported & motivated in their goals this month.


Michael McDonald, Bar Manager & Spirits Ambassador, took this challenge on. Mike picked up Zero by Grant Achatz of The Aviary in Chicago, a cocktail book devoted to the exploration of non-alcoholic approaches to cocktails. Using glycerin & a variety of botanicals, Mike then developed non-alcoholic imitations for some of your favorite State Line spirits like American Gin & Aquavit. Once the desired flavor profile was reached, Mike built two menus of original cocktails with the new spirit imitators for anyone to enjoy.


If you haven’t tried our Spirits Free or Touch of Spirits menus yet, the last day to try most of these originals is Tuesday, January 31st. We were inspired by this month, and in response, we will be updating our N/A offerings after January to make sure everyone finds something they love.
